18得票5回答
在Android Leanback ListRow中滚动到指定位置

我正在使用Google的Leanback小部件在Android TV应用程序中。它利用了一个包含ListRows的RowsFragment。 我尝试确定是否有任何方法可以编程方式滚动到一行中特定对象的位置。我已经查阅了Leanback小部件的文档,但没有找到我要找的内容。

16得票2回答
限制ListRow的滚动速度

我在查看 Netflix 应用程序及其滚动行为。我想要做相同的事情,但不知道从哪里开始。我知道如何覆盖 RecyclerView 的 LayoutManager(虽然我不想把这个作为最后的选择)。是否有更简单的方法使用 RowPresenter 控制滚动速度?

14得票1回答
如何使用Paging Library在Leanback VerticalGridSupportFragment中实现分页?

我们正在尝试使用Architecture Components Paging Library在Leanback VerticalGridSupportFragment中实现分页。由于Leanback本身没有任何与Paging Library的兼容性,所以我们扩展了它的ObjectAdapter...

13得票5回答
去除Leanback VerticalGridFragment顶部间距

我正在使用VerticalGridFragment来以网格形式布局显示项目。 我不需要显示搜索或标题,并且我希望行从屏幕顶部开始,没有任何边距。 有什么建议吗?

13得票3回答
Android TV:更改浏览片段行标题的文本颜色和字体

如何更改浏览片段中行标题的文本颜色和字体? 不是菜单中的文本,而是出现在行上方的文本。

11得票3回答
如何更改ImageCardView中信息区域的背景颜色?

我试图在Android Leanback Library的中,当选中卡片时更改infoArea的背景颜色。目前我尝试过的方法是在中更改背景。这样可以改变背景,但是不会清除之前选择的项目。private final class ItemViewSelectedListener implement...

11得票3回答
Leanback.DetailsFragment不能按预期滚动

我有一个细节片段,使用了DetailsOverviewRow和FullWidthDetailsOverviewRowPresenter。当页面刚加载时,动作按钮被选中。当我按下一次后,焦点离开按钮,没有其他反应。当我第二次按下时,焦点移到了页面下面的ListRow。我正在试图弄清楚为什么概述部...

11得票3回答
Android TV的Leanback RowsFragment如何使焦点项保持在开头位置

我正在开发一个Leanback应用,通过RowsFragment实现了行和所有内容,一切都很好。 目前当我在行中左右移动时,焦点项会移动到屏幕中间并获得焦点。 例子 - 我希望焦点项目停留在行的开头而不是中间。 例子 - 在网络上找不到关于此问题的任何信息。非常感谢您提供任...

10得票3回答
在Android TV Leanback中实现文件对话框

我有一个dirPath的String变量,我希望能够将其更改为我选择的目录,用于Android TV应用程序。我发现Leanback框架的幻灯片式界面对于微妙的操作有点笨重,但是我想尽可能地坚持使用它,因为我完全是初学者,对Android和Java都不熟悉。 因此,试图坚持最佳实践,我希望用...

10得票2回答
在BrowseFragment中为每个Header提供多个ListRow - Leanback库

我正在为我们的应用程序启用Leanback支持。根据UI要求,我需要添加多个列表行,对应每个标题,就像Youtube在Android TV上所做的那样。默认的ListRowPresenter似乎只呈现一个列表行及其标题。是否有支持多个列表行的presenter可用?我的想法是创建一个自定义的p...